Sustainable Transport Approaches
To combat environmental degradation and promote urban health, cities worldwide are increasingly adopting innovative sustainable transport strategies. These policies aim to reduce reliance on private vehicles by incentivizing the use of public transportation, cycling, and walking. Investments in expanded public transport systems, protected bike lanes, and pedestrian-friendly infrastructure are crucial components of these initiatives. Furthermore, enforcing policies such as congestion charging and parking restrictions can help to discourage car usage. By moving towards sustainable transport modes, cities can create a more sustainable future for generations to come.
